## Data Stores — Shelfbound Catalogue Import

The Shelfbound importer pulls nightly MARC dumps from partner libraries into the Stacks database. Staging tables are truncated before each run; the merged catalogue lives in the `holdings` schema. If the import stalls, check the dedupe job first — it holds long locks. On-call can verify row counts directly against the primary using the connection string below.

primary connection of yagep-kahip = redis://giliel_svc:zYiKsLL2PLpfPL@db-348f.xolmarsys.corp:5432/fenwyn

Regional Sales Review — Managers Only

This page summarizes the Northgate region's half-year performance. Revenue from the Tellaro product family grew 4%, while the Mirefield territory underdelivered against quota for a third consecutive quarter. Finance should note the revised commission accruals before closing the period. Full territory breakdowns are attached. The following note is confidential and must not leave this group.

management briefing: Project Ulavan slips by two quarters because of the staffing delay.

## SQL Lint — Environments

The Quernstone lint service applies the same rule set in all environments, but severity thresholds differ: warnings block merges only in prod-config. Plugin authors should target the staging rule profile when testing custom rules. The staging profile currently resolves to the following values.

service settings:
WENATH_PIN=5007
WENATH_METRICS_HOST=metrics.wenath.tolvaqlabs.corp
WENATH_LOG_LEVEL=debug
WENATH_TENANT=rusox

**Alertmesh Dedup — Weekly Eng Sync Notes**

Alertmesh collapses duplicate pages before they reach PagerPath, keyed on fingerprint and a five-minute window. New on-call folks should confirm dedup rules in the Alertmesh console before their first rotation. To query suppressed alerts locally, the CLI needs access to the internal Alertmesh API. Use the key below.

API key for fahip-kahip: zpat23_XiJGUHz5xfaAtaIqUkus0rh